AROMATIZATION OF C_6 PARAFFIN OVER Pt/ML(M=K,Rb)AND Pt/AlPO_4-5 CATALYSTS AT DIFFERENT TEMPERATURE

摘    要:The reaction product distributions from the reactions of n-C6 and MCP over different Pt-catalysts at different temperatures were studied. It is shown that the product distributions depended on the reaction temperatures The influences of the zeolite channel functioned only at high temperature. The activity and selectivity of aromatization of n-C6 over Pt/AIPO4-5 were lower than those over Pt/L zeolite catalysts. A1PO4-5 is a non-basic support and its product distribution and reaction mechanism were different from that of basic-support catalysts such as Pt/KL and Pt/RbL.
